Nuts
//nʌts// adj, intj, noun, verb, slang
Definitions
Adjective
- 1 Insane, mad. colloquial
"After living on the island alone for five years, he eventually went nuts."
- 2 Crazy, mad; unusually pleased or, alternatively, angered. colloquial
"I just go nuts over her fantastic desserts."
- 3 Very fond of (on) someone. colloquial
"He's been nuts on her since the day they met."
Adjective
- 1 informal or slang terms for mentally irregular wordnet
Intj
- 1 Indicates annoyance, anger, or disappointment.
"Nuts! They didn't even listen to what I had to say."
- 2 Signifies rejection of a proposal or idea, as in forget it, no way, or nothing doing; often followed by to.
"They want me to pay $5 for a banana? Nuts to that!"
Noun
- 1 plural of nut form-of, plural
- 2 The testicles. plural, plural-only, slang
- 3 initialism of Nomenclature des unités territoriales statistiques: (Nomenclature of Territorial Units for Statistics or Nomenclature of Units for Territorial Statistics - an EU classification system of geographical administrative areas for statistical purposes). abbreviation, alt-of, initialism, uncountable
- 4 An unbeatable hand; the best poker hand available. plural, plural-only
"If the board is 237QA, all of spades, the nuts is 45 of spades."
Verb
- 1 third-person singular simple present indicative of nut form-of, indicative, present, singular, third-person
